GIAC Network Forensic Analyst (GNFA) Sample Questions:
Question 1
What is a key limitation of NetFlow in network forensics?
Response:
A. It does not capture payload data
B. It only supports TCP-based traffic
C. It does not log timestamps
D. It cannot detect encrypted traffic
Question 2
Which of the following best describes asymmetric encryption?
Response:
A. Uses a predefined lookup table for encoding data
B. Uses different keys for encryption and decryption
C. Uses the same key for encryption and decryption
D. Converts plaintext into a hash that cannot be reversed
Question 3
Which of the following is a security risk associated with open Wi-Fi networks?
Response:
A. Unauthenticated access
B. Multi-factor authentication
C. Encryption key rotation
D. VLAN segmentation
Question 4
Which protocol operates at Layer 3 of the OSI model and is responsible for logical addressing?
Response:
A. IP
B. UDP
C. TCP
D. ARP
Question 5
Which of the following hashing algorithms is considered weak due to its vulnerability to collisions?
Response:
A. AES-256
B. MD5
C. RSA-2048
D. SHA-512
Solutions:
| Question 1 Answer: A | Question 2 Answer: B | Question 3 Answer: A | Question 4 Answer: A | Question 5 Answer: B |
